Imagine being one of the most powerful figures in a booming industry during the Wild West — and achieving all this in a time when women rarely held any sway in the business world. This was the reality for Emma Summers, a remarkable woman who rose to prominence in the late 19th and early 20th centuries as a dominant force in the burgeoning oil industry in Los Angeles, California. Born Emma McCutchen in Kentucky in 1858, Summers became known as the 'Oil Queen of California.' As a former music teacher, nobody could have predicted that she would leave such a significant impact on the American economy and pave a path for future women in business.

From Pianos to Petroleum

Emma Summers' transformation from piano teacher to oil magnate is a fascinating journey. After moving to Los Angeles with her husband, Alpha Wright Summers, in 1893, Emma initially supplemented their income by teaching music. However, the burgeoning oil industry, sparked by the discovery of oil in Southern California, caught her attention and sparked a daring ambition. In a time when women were discouraged from entering business, let alone the rough-and-tumble world of oil, Summers fearlessly invested in oil wells.

Armed with $700—an enormous sum in those days—she managed to secure her first well in the Los Angeles City Oil Field. Intriguingly, her success wasn't just a stroke of luck. Emma's shrewd business sense was instrumental. She didn’t merely lease or drill wells randomly; she strategically purchased failing wells and optimally consolidated their resources, thereby increasing output and success where others had failed. Soon, her strategic acumen allowed her to control a significant portion of the oil supply. By the turn of the century, she owned 14 wells producing 50,000 barrels of oil a month!

Tactical Triumphs in Uncertain Times

What makes Emma Summers' achievements particularly astonishing is her ability to navigate through numerous challenges, such as natural disasters and economic fluctuations, with forethought and resilience. Consider the period of the 1906 San Francisco earthquake, a time when oil supplies were severely disrupted. While others were losing ground, Summers deftly maintained her operations and continued to supply oil at stable prices, further solidifying her economic position and earning her the moniker 'Oil Queen of California.'

Her business model was incredibly advanced for her era. Summers implemented what we might consider 'vertical integration' long before it became a buzzword. By owning not only the oil wells but also engaging in transporting and marketing her product, she cut through several layers of middlemen, maximizing efficiency and profits.

Breaking Through Gender Barriers

Emma Summers’ accomplishments are also remarkable for the stiff gender barriers she overcame. During her era, societal norms strictly prescribed defined roles for women, primarily as homemakers or subordinates in any business endeavor. Yet, Emma defied these conventions and managed her empire with savvy and authority, negotiating contracts and dealing with labor disputes. Often, she even donned the unconventional garb of overalls to tend directly to her wells, demonstrating hands-on leadership.
